A Note About "Felting"
"Felting" or "fulling" is a process that shrinks crocheted or knitted items that are made of 100% wool. If a description says that one of my items is "machine felted" that means that I threw the product in the washing machine to shrink it. If it is "hand felted," I scrubbed the item over the stove in hot soapy water (with gloves of course!). A purse that has been felted does not need a lining because the shrinkage and agitation makes it pretty hard for keys and pens to poke through the fabric. On the hand felted items, stitches are still visible, but the item will still be sturdy enough to hold all of your goodies.
